New Storytelling Event In Kona Is a Monthly Must-Do
Join Kupuna, Hawaiian entertainers and Kumu Hula who will bring the past to the present with mele, dance, and storytelling every month on the Friday of the Mahealani Moon (full moon) at the Hulihe’e Palace, 75-5718 Alii Dr, Kailua Kona, HI 96740. This is a free event open to the community. The performance begins at 6:30 pm, with gates opening at 5:30 pm. Attendees should bring their own Hali’i and chairs.

About “Under the Kona Moon”
The mission of Under the Kona Moon is to be a gathering place for Hawaiʻi Island ʻohana and kupuna to bring the past to life. Graced by a majestic moon, the ancient art of mele, hula, and storytelling will unveil and celebrate the past, and continue to strengthen and preserve future generations. The concept was inspired by Twilight at Kalahuipua’a at the Mauna Lani Resort.
